How much do python cloud eng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for python cloud engineer in Minnesota is $137,089.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$108,200.00 and $161,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Python Cloud Engineer do?

A Python Cloud Engineer is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ining cloud-based applications and infrastructure using the Python programming language. They work with cloud platforms like A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ud to build scalable, secure, and efficient solutions. Their tasks often include writing automation scripts, deploying cloud resources, and ensuring the reliability and performance of cloud systems. They also collaborate with development and operations teams to streamline cloud workflows and troubleshoot issues.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Python Cloud Engineer?

To thrive as a Python Cloud Engineer, you need strong proficiency in Python programming, a good understanding of cloud platforms like A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ud, and experience with infrastructure-as-code and automation tools. Familiarity with CI/CD pipelines, containerization technologies (such as Docker and Kubernetes), and relevant certifications like AWS Certified Developer or Google Cloud Professional are typically important. Excellent problem-solving, collaboration, and communication skills help you navigate complex projects and work effectively in cross-functional teams. These skills and qualities are essential for developing, deploying, and maintaining scalable cloud-based solutions efficiently and securely.

How does a Python Cloud Engineer typically collaborate with cross-functional teams on cloud-based projects?

Python Cloud Engineers frequently work alongside DevOps specialists, software developers, and cloud architects to design, implement, and optimize cloud solutions. They are often involved in code reviews, infrastructure automation, and troubleshooting sessions, ensuring that services are scalable and reliable. Regular communication, agile methodologies, and shared documentation are key practices, enabling smooth integration of cloud-native applications and services across the organization.

What is the difference between Python Cloud Engineer vs Cloud Software Developer?

AspectPython Cloud EngineerCloud Software Developer
Required CredentialsPython certifications, cloud platform certifications (AWS, Azure)Programming certifications, cloud platform knowledge
Work EnvironmentCloud environments, DevOps tools, scriptingApplication development, cloud deployment
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, cloud service providersSoftware firms, SaaS providers
Search & Comparison IntentYesYes

The main difference is that Python Cloud Engineers focus on designing and maintaining cloud infrastructure using Python, while Cloud Software Developers primarily develop applications for cloud platforms. Both roles require cloud platform knowledge and programming skills but differ in their core responsibilities and focus areas.
